This fight between Jeff Fenech and Samart Payakaroon took place on at the Entertainment Centre, Sydney, Australia.
At 173 cm, Samart Payakaroon is the taller of the two by 2 cms; Jeff Fenech is 171 cm. Besides being the taller fighter, with a reach of 173 cm, Payakaroon also has reach advantage of 2 cms over Fenech's 171 cm. They have the same ape index of 0 cm.
Fenech is coming in to this fight with an undefeated record of 15-0 (12 KOs). His last fight was 2 months and 5 days ago against Tony Miller, which he won via 12 round unanimous decision.
Payakaroon also comes in with an undefeated record of 14-0 (8 KOs). His last fight was 5 months and 29 days ago against Juan Meza, which he won via 12th round TKO.
Jeff Fenech fights out of the orthodox stance, while Samart Payakaroon fights out of the southpaw stance.
On the day of the fight, Fenech will be 23 years old. Payakaroon will be 24 years and 6 months old.

Jeff Fenech defeated Samart Payakaroon via 4th round KO to win the WBC super-bantamweight title. Payakaroon's undefeated record of 14 wins comes to an end, and Fenech advances his win streak to 16. Fenech is now 16-0, and Payakaroon 14-1.
